How they compare

Chile currently reports 7,705 against 7,498 in El Salvador, a difference of 207.

The two have swapped places 10 times across 69 shared years of data; in 1950 it was Chile ahead.

Chile ranks 71st and El Salvador ranks 73rd of 161 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 4 and El Salvador in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Chile El Salvador Difference Ahead
1950s 5,225 10,827 5,602 El Salvador
1960s 9,485 92,709 83,224 El Salvador
1970s 34,112 71,516 37,405 El Salvador
1980s 62,817 43,765 19,052 Chile
1990s 111,445 29,023 82,422 Chile
2000s 51,365 13,027 38,338 Chile
2010s 11,403 6,071 5,331 Chile

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
